 
																												
														
														
													J.T. Realmuto is regarded as the best defensive catcher in the game. He is elite at being on the same page as his pitchers, alongside his ability to frame, throw runners out, and keep the ball in front of him.
However, the Philadelphia Phillies are at risk of losing their backstop after seven seasons. Realmuto will become a free agent at the end of the season and could be a tough player to retain.
They are also at risk of losing Kyle Schwarber, which could hurt the team’s ability to retain both. However, one player’s market could be quite bigger than the others, and it’s not who you think.
Execs suggest J.T. Realmuto could draw more free-agent interest than Kyle Schwarber
If you were to ask 100 fans who would have the biggest market over the winter between the two, almost all of them would say Kyle Schwarber. He is coming off a career-best season where he launched 56 home runs and did not miss a single game during the regular season.
However, according to team insider Matt Gelb, MLB executives believe J.T. Realmuto will have the larger market.
“But some rival executives expect Realmuto to draw more free-agent interest this winter than Kyle Schwarber. That’s not to suggest Realmuto will receive a larger deal than Schwarber; he won’t. But the sheer number of teams interested in Realmuto could boost his market.”
Realmuto will not cost quite as much as Schwarber, which could generate more interest. That could seriously jeopardize Philadelphia’s chances of re-signing its prized backstop, which would be quite the loss.
